Code :: Blocks is free open source cross-platform C++ integrated development environment. It supports plug-ins, debugger, integrated with the GCC compiler and Visual C++. Moreover, Code::Blocks can be used for programming ARM, AVR, D, DirectX, FLTK, Fortran, GLFW, GLUT, GTK +, Irrlicht, Lightfeather, MATLAB, OGRE, OpenGL, Qt, SDL, SFML, and STL. The interface is very similar to Visual Studio. read more...

BRL-CAD

BRL-CAD is a cross-platform open source constructive solid geometry (CSG) modeling computer-aided design (CAD). The program helps to create three-dimensional objects using an interactive geometry editor. Freeware also supports the rendering benchmark. It should be noted that it takes some time to be able to fully understand it. read more...

Project management


OpenProj

OpenProj is a very good free software for project planning. The program includes all necessary functions Gantt charts, network traffic, resource allocation, reports. Moreover,the application supports import and export of Microsoft Project documents. read more...


FreeMind

FreeMind is free easy-to-use cross-platform program to create diagrams of mind maps. The program’s main function is to representate and structure information about the project. It supports import and export in the following formats JPEG, HTML, OpenDocument TextXHTML, PNG, and XML. Freeware has a multilingual interface. Moreover, the program can encrypt the document, both separate parts and the whole file. read more...

